About the LIAC-BBA
The Lebanese and International Arbitration Center of the Beirut Bar Association (LIAC-BBA) is an autonomous arbitration body of the Beirut Bar Association that provides arbitration and alternative dispute resolution services for resolving domestic and international disputes.
Although part of the organization of the Beirut Bar Association, the LIAC-BBA carries out its functions in complete independence from the Beirut Bar Association and its organs. It is governed by its internal regulations and performs its duties under the supervision of its own bodies.
The LIAC-BBA does not itself resolve disputes. It administers proceedings in accordance with its arbitration rules.
In addition, the LIAC may be designated as appointing authority without subjecting the arbitration to the LIAC rules.
Administrative Committee
The Administrative Committee of the LIAC-BBA oversees the administrative and financial activities of the Arbitration Center.
Higher Arbitration Council
The Higher Arbitration Council of the LIAC-BBA makes decisions in accordance with the LIAC-BBA rules relating to pending arbitrations.
SECRETARIAT
The LIAC-BBA Secretariat carries out the daily functions in the administration of arbitrations and mediations.
